What does LEECHED mean?
Leeched is a form of LEECH.
- noun
carnivorous or bloodsucking aquatic or terrestrial worms typically having a sucker at each end
- noun
a follower who hangs around a host (without benefit to the host) in hope of gain or advantage
- verb
draw blood
“In the old days, doctors routinely bled patients as part of the treatment”
Definitions from WordNet 3.1, Princeton University.
